Fentanyl Patches for Opioid Use Disorder: The Next Kadian?
Addiction Medicine Fellow, BC Centre on Substance Use
June 2, 2026
12pm – 1pm PT
Learning Objectives:
- Describe the rationale for transdermal fentanyl as an emerging intervention in the fentanyl era.
- Evaluate the current evidence, safety considerations, and broader implications of fentanyl patches for opioid use disorder.
What’s New in Addiction Medicine? is a lunch-time series featuring clinicians and researchers from BCCSU’s interdisciplinary fellowship program, who will deliver the latest research and information on novel, evidence-based addiction medicine topics.
This free series is geared towards the needs and interests of individuals operating in a healthcare or research setting, however, everyone is welcome and encouraged to attend.
